On Sun, Nov 24, 2002 at 04:10:56PM +0000, Rui Carmo wrote:
Having suffered from repeated rxvt hangs, I dutifully downloaded the latest Cygwin DLL update, rebooted and resumed working on one of my pet projects: a barbaric hack of the netatalk packages to try and get an AppleShare IP file service running under cygwin.Yep, and they are all in http://cygwin.com/bugs.html
Almost immediatly, however, I began getting messages like this:
11 [sig] bash 2808 winpids::enumNT: error 0xC0000005 reading system process information
...when running configure/shell/Perl scripts. I copied my build tree across to another box (with the older Cygwin version) and re-ran the relevant scripts - without any of these error messages.
I'm pretty sure this is related to the new version, since it was the only change on my main box (I had upgraded everything a couple of days or on all boxes).
Any ideas?
